European Gas Market Firm as LNG Supply Risks Persist

European natural gas prices traded above €65/MWh, their highest level since January 2023, driven by mounting concerns over global LNG supply. The conflict in the Middle East has disrupted roughly one-fifth of global LNG flows, undermining Europe’s ability to build inventories over the summer. EU gas storage facilities are currently about 63% full—the lowest seasonal level since 2009 and significantly below long-term norms.

The European Commission nevertheless remains confident that ample spare LNG import capacity, combined with an 80% storage target, will be sufficient to cover winter demand. Even so, Europe is likely to face strong competition from Asian buyers for spot LNG cargoes. At the same time, tentative signs of improved transit through the Strait of Hormuz, along with discussions over a potential Iran–Oman shipping corridor, have reduced immediate fears of further physical supply interruptions. As a result, market focus is gradually shifting away from the risk of an acute supply shock toward the broader economic and sanctions-related implications of developments involving Iran.
